Skip to content
This repository has been archived by the owner on Sep 14, 2023. It is now read-only.

chore: import map pattern imports in examples to align with node equivalent #1018

Closed
wants to merge 4 commits into from
Closed
Show file tree
Hide file tree
Changes from 2 commits
Commits
File filter

Filter by extension

Filter by extension

Conversations
Failed to load comments.
Loading
Jump to
Jump to file
Failed to load files.
Loading
Diff view
Diff view
2 changes: 1 addition & 1 deletion examples/blocks.eg.ts
Original file line number Diff line number Diff line change
Expand Up @@ -8,7 +8,7 @@

import { $eventRecord, metadata, polkadot } from "@capi/polkadot"
import { $, $extrinsic, known, Rune } from "capi"
import { babeBlockAuthor } from "capi/patterns/consensus/mod.ts"
import { babeBlockAuthor } from "capi/patterns/consensus"

/// Reference the latest block hash.
const blockHash = polkadot.blockHash()
Expand Down
2 changes: 1 addition & 1 deletion examples/dev/storage_sizes.eg.ts
Original file line number Diff line number Diff line change
Expand Up @@ -9,7 +9,7 @@

import { polkadotDev } from "@capi/polkadot-dev"
import { $ } from "capi"
import { storageSizes } from "capi/patterns/storage_sizes.ts"
import { storageSizes } from "capi/patterns/storage_sizes"

/// Use the storageSizes factory to produce a Rune. Then execute it.
const sizes = await storageSizes(polkadotDev).run()
Expand Down
4 changes: 2 additions & 2 deletions examples/ink/deploy.eg.ts
Original file line number Diff line number Diff line change
Expand Up @@ -8,8 +8,8 @@

import { contractsDev } from "@capi/contracts-dev"
import { $, createDevUsers, hex, Sr25519, ss58 } from "capi"
import { InkMetadataRune } from "capi/patterns/ink/mod.ts"
import { signature } from "capi/patterns/signature/polkadot.ts"
import { InkMetadataRune } from "capi/patterns/ink"
import { signature } from "capi/patterns/signature/polkadot"

/// Initialize an `InkMetadataRune` with the raw Ink metadata text.
const metadata = InkMetadataRune.fromMetadataText(
Expand Down
4 changes: 2 additions & 2 deletions examples/ink/interact.eg.ts
Original file line number Diff line number Diff line change
Expand Up @@ -9,8 +9,8 @@
import { contractsDev } from "@capi/contracts-dev"
import { assert } from "asserts"
import { $, createDevUsers, hex } from "capi"
import { InkMetadataRune } from "capi/patterns/ink/mod.ts"
import { signature } from "capi/patterns/signature/polkadot.ts"
import { InkMetadataRune } from "capi/patterns/ink"
import { signature } from "capi/patterns/signature/polkadot"

/// Get two test users. Alexa will deploy, Billy will be the recipient of an erc20
/// token transfer.
Expand Down
4 changes: 2 additions & 2 deletions examples/misc/identity.eg.ts
Original file line number Diff line number Diff line change
Expand Up @@ -8,8 +8,8 @@

import { polkadotDev } from "@capi/polkadot-dev"
import { $, createDevUsers } from "capi"
import { IdentityInfoTranscoders } from "capi/patterns/identity.ts"
import { signature } from "capi/patterns/signature/polkadot.ts"
import { IdentityInfoTranscoders } from "capi/patterns/identity"
import { signature } from "capi/patterns/signature/polkadot"

const { alexa } = await createDevUsers()

Expand Down
2 changes: 1 addition & 1 deletion examples/misc/indices.eg.ts
Original file line number Diff line number Diff line change
Expand Up @@ -8,7 +8,7 @@
import { polkadotDev } from "@capi/polkadot-dev"
import { assertEquals } from "asserts"
import { createDevUsers } from "capi"
import { signature } from "capi/patterns/signature/polkadot.ts"
import { signature } from "capi/patterns/signature/polkadot"

const { alexa } = await createDevUsers()

Expand Down
4 changes: 2 additions & 2 deletions examples/multisig/basic.eg.ts
Original file line number Diff line number Diff line change
Expand Up @@ -8,8 +8,8 @@
import { polkadotDev } from "@capi/polkadot-dev"
import { assert } from "asserts"
import { $, createDevUsers } from "capi"
import { MultisigRune } from "capi/patterns/multisig/mod.ts"
import { signature } from "capi/patterns/signature/polkadot.ts"
import { MultisigRune } from "capi/patterns/multisig"
import { signature } from "capi/patterns/signature/polkadot"

const { alexa, billy, carol, david } = await createDevUsers()

Expand Down
6 changes: 3 additions & 3 deletions examples/multisig/stash.eg.ts
Original file line number Diff line number Diff line change
Expand Up @@ -8,9 +8,9 @@
import { MultiAddress, polkadotDev } from "@capi/polkadot-dev"
import { assert } from "asserts"
import { createDevUsers } from "capi"
import { MultisigRune } from "capi/patterns/multisig/mod.ts"
import { filterPureCreatedEvents } from "capi/patterns/proxy/mod.ts"
import { signature } from "capi/patterns/signature/polkadot.ts"
import { MultisigRune } from "capi/patterns/multisig"
import { filterPureCreatedEvents } from "capi/patterns/proxy"
import { signature } from "capi/patterns/signature/polkadot"

const { alexa, billy, carol } = await createDevUsers()

Expand Down
4 changes: 2 additions & 2 deletions examples/multisig/virtual.eg.ts
Original file line number Diff line number Diff line change
Expand Up @@ -20,8 +20,8 @@
import { MultiAddress, polkadotDev } from "@capi/polkadot-dev"
import { assert } from "asserts"
import { $, createDevUsers, Rune, Sr25519 } from "capi"
import { VirtualMultisigRune } from "capi/patterns/multisig/mod.ts"
import { signature } from "capi/patterns/signature/polkadot.ts"
import { VirtualMultisigRune } from "capi/patterns/multisig"
import { signature } from "capi/patterns/signature/polkadot"
import { parse } from "../../deps/std/flags.ts"

const { alexa, billy, carol, david } = await createDevUsers()
Expand Down
4 changes: 2 additions & 2 deletions examples/nfts.eg.ts
Original file line number Diff line number Diff line change
Expand Up @@ -16,8 +16,8 @@ import {
} from "@capi/rococo-dev-westmint"
import { assertEquals } from "asserts"
import { $, createDevUsers, Rune } from "capi"
import { DefaultCollectionSetting, DefaultItemSetting } from "capi/patterns/nfts.ts"
import { signature } from "capi/patterns/signature/statemint.ts"
import { DefaultCollectionSetting, DefaultItemSetting } from "capi/patterns/nfts"
import { signature } from "capi/patterns/signature/statemint"

/// Create two dev users. Alexa will mint and list the NFT. Billy will purchase it.
const { alexa, billy } = await createDevUsers()
Expand Down
2 changes: 1 addition & 1 deletion examples/sign/ed25519.eg.ts
Original file line number Diff line number Diff line change
Expand Up @@ -7,7 +7,7 @@
import { MultiAddress, westendDev } from "@capi/westend-dev"
import { assert } from "asserts"
import { createDevUsers, ExtrinsicSender } from "capi"
import { signature } from "capi/patterns/signature/polkadot.ts"
import { signature } from "capi/patterns/signature/polkadot"
import * as ed from "../../deps/ed25519.ts"

const { alexa, billy } = await createDevUsers()
Expand Down
2 changes: 1 addition & 1 deletion examples/sign/offline.eg.ts
Original file line number Diff line number Diff line change
Expand Up @@ -7,7 +7,7 @@

import { $runtimeCall, westendDev } from "@capi/westend-dev"
import { $, createDevUsers, SignedExtrinsicRune } from "capi"
import { signature } from "capi/patterns/signature/polkadot.ts"
import { signature } from "capi/patterns/signature/polkadot"

const { alexa, billy } = await createDevUsers()

Expand Down
4 changes: 2 additions & 2 deletions examples/sign/pjs.eg.ts
Original file line number Diff line number Diff line change
Expand Up @@ -7,8 +7,8 @@

import { polkadotDev } from "@capi/polkadot-dev"
import { createDevUsers, ss58 } from "capi"
import { pjsSender, PjsSigner } from "capi/patterns/compat/pjs_sender.ts"
import { signature } from "capi/patterns/signature/polkadot.ts"
import { pjsSender, PjsSigner } from "capi/patterns/compat/pjs_sender"
import { signature } from "capi/patterns/signature/polkadot"
import { createPair } from "https://deno.land/x/[email protected]/keyring/mod.ts"
import { TypeRegistry } from "https://deno.land/x/[email protected]/types/mod.ts"

Expand Down
2 changes: 1 addition & 1 deletion examples/tx/balances_transfer.eg.ts
Original file line number Diff line number Diff line change
Expand Up @@ -7,7 +7,7 @@
import { westendDev } from "@capi/westend-dev"
import { assert } from "asserts"
import { createDevUsers } from "capi"
import { signature } from "capi/patterns/signature/polkadot.ts"
import { signature } from "capi/patterns/signature/polkadot"

/// Create two dev users. Alexa will send the funds to Billy.
const { alexa, billy } = await createDevUsers()
Expand Down
2 changes: 1 addition & 1 deletion examples/tx/handle_errors.eg.ts
Original file line number Diff line number Diff line change
Expand Up @@ -8,7 +8,7 @@
import { contractsDev } from "@capi/contracts-dev"
import { assertInstanceOf } from "asserts"
import { createDevUsers, ExtrinsicError } from "capi"
import { signature } from "capi/patterns/signature/polkadot.ts"
import { signature } from "capi/patterns/signature/polkadot"

const { alexa, billy } = await createDevUsers()

Expand Down
2 changes: 1 addition & 1 deletion examples/tx/utility_batch.eg.ts
Original file line number Diff line number Diff line change
Expand Up @@ -7,7 +7,7 @@
import { westendDev } from "@capi/westend-dev"
import { assert } from "asserts"
import { createDevUsers, Rune } from "capi"
import { signature } from "capi/patterns/signature/polkadot.ts"
import { signature } from "capi/patterns/signature/polkadot"

/// Create four dev users, one of whom will be the batch sender. The other
/// three will be recipients of balance transfers described in the batch.
Expand Down
2 changes: 1 addition & 1 deletion examples/xcm/asset_teleportation.eg.ts
Original file line number Diff line number Diff line change
Expand Up @@ -27,7 +27,7 @@ import {
} from "@capi/rococo-dev-westmint"
import { assert } from "asserts"
import { createDevUsers, Rune } from "capi"
import { signature } from "capi/patterns/signature/polkadot.ts"
import { signature } from "capi/patterns/signature/polkadot"

const { alexa } = await createDevUsers()

Expand Down
4 changes: 2 additions & 2 deletions examples/xcm/reserve_transfer.eg.ts
Original file line number Diff line number Diff line change
Expand Up @@ -28,8 +28,8 @@ import {
import { rococoDevXcmTrappist } from "@capi/rococo-dev-xcm-trappist"
import { assert, assertNotEquals } from "asserts"
import { $, alice as root, createDevUsers, Rune, ValueRune } from "capi"
import { $siblId } from "capi/patterns/para_id.ts"
import { signature } from "capi/patterns/signature/statemint.ts"
import { $siblId } from "capi/patterns/para_id"
import { signature } from "capi/patterns/signature/statemint"
import { retry } from "../../deps/std/async.ts"

const { alexa, billy } = await createDevUsers()
Expand Down
13 changes: 12 additions & 1 deletion import_map.json
Original file line number Diff line number Diff line change
Expand Up @@ -6,7 +6,18 @@
"examples/": {
"asserts": "./deps/std/testing/asserts.ts",
"capi": "./mod.ts",
"capi/patterns/": "./patterns/"
"capi/patterns/": "./patterns/",
harrysolovay marked this conversation as resolved.
Show resolved Hide resolved
"capi/patterns/compat/pjs_sender": "./patterns/compat/pjs_sender.ts",
"capi/patterns/consensus": "./patterns/consensus/mod.ts",
"capi/patterns/identity": "./patterns/identity.ts",
"capi/patterns/ink": "./patterns/ink/mod.ts",
"capi/patterns/multisig": "./patterns/multisig/mod.ts",
"capi/patterns/nfts": "./patterns/nfts.ts",
"capi/patterns/para_id": "./patterns/para_id.ts",
"capi/patterns/proxy": "./patterns/proxy/mod.ts",
"capi/patterns/signature/polkadot": "./patterns/signature/polkadot.ts",
"capi/patterns/signature/statemint": "./patterns/signature/statemint.ts",
"capi/patterns/storage_sizes": "./patterns/storage_sizes.ts"
},
"http://localhost:4646/": {
"http://localhost:4646/capi/": "./"
Expand Down
1 change: 1 addition & 0 deletions words.txt
Original file line number Diff line number Diff line change
Expand Up @@ -15,6 +15,7 @@ chelios
chev
childstate
codegen
compat
concat
deno
denoland
Expand Down